MRT, the FYR Macedonian national broadcaster has confirmed to ESCToday that the 2015 Macedonian Eurovision national final- Skopje Fest 2014 will be held on 12 November.

The  FYR Macedonian broadcaster has preponed its Eurovision national final, thus bringing it forward by one day from its initial scheduled date 13 November. Hence the 2015 Eurovision season will officially kick off on 12 November when FYR Macedonia selects its Eurovision act and entry.

MRT has received around 200 entries for Skopje Fest, out of which the broadcaster has selected a total of 13 songs for the grand finale. It is yet unclear how many songs will compete in the national final, but has MRT confirmed to ESCToday  that no more than 20 songs will battle for the golden ticket to Vienna (13 shortlisted entries+ 5 or 7 entries from invited composers). MRT will be announcing  the total number of participants along with  names of the competing acts and entries tonight.

In 2015 FYR Macedonia will select its entry via the 2014 Scopje Song Festival which is scheduled to be held on the 12 November with no more than 20 acts competing for the golden ticket to Austria. Hence the winner of the celebrated Skopje Song Festival will represent FYR Macedonia at the 2015 Eurovision Song Contest. The 2015 Macedonian Eurovision entry will be selected via a 50/50 public televoting- International jury deliberation.

In 2014 MRT selected Tijana Dapcevic via an internal selection with her entry To the Sky to represent FYR Macedonia at the 2015 Eurovision Song Contest in Copenhagen. Despite an energetic performance Tijana failed to qualify to the grand final.

FYR Macedonia debuted at the Eurovision Song Contest in 1998 and is yet to win the event. The country achieved its best placing in the contest in 2006 with Elena Risteka’s Ninanajna.
